Which companies sponsor visas for branch managers in Virginia?
Banks and financial institutions are the most active sponsors for branch manager roles in Virginia. Bank of America, Wells Fargo, TD Bank, and PNC Bank have Virginia locations with documented H-1B sponsorship histories. Beyond banking, regional employers in logistics, retail, and credit unions operating across Northern Virginia and the Richmond metro also sponsor qualified candidates, though sponsorship varies by company and position.
Which visa types are most common for branch manager roles in Virginia?
The H-1B is the most common visa for branch managers in Virginia, provided the role requires a bachelor's degree in a specific field such as business administration, finance, or management. The L-1A is an option for intracompany transferees moving into a managerial capacity from an overseas office of the same employer. TN visas cover Canadian and Mexican nationals in qualifying management roles under USMCA.

Are there state-specific considerations for branch manager visa sponsorship in Virginia?
Virginia's branch manager market is shaped by its Northern Virginia financial services concentration and proximity to federal contracting employers, which affects prevailing wage benchmarks set by the Department of Labor. Employers filing Labor Condition Applications for branch manager roles in the Washington-Arlington-Alexandria metro area typically face higher prevailing wage requirements than those in more rural parts of the state, which can influence which employers actively pursue sponsorship.
What is the prevailing wage for sponsored branch manager jobs in Virginia?
U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
